WebJun 18, 2024 · Centrifugation is used for both thickening and dewatering of sewage sludge, where dewatered sludge has a higher dry solids ( DS) concentration. The centrifuge technologies used for each is almost identical. The key operational differences between the two functions are: the rotation speed employed the throughput, and

WebUsed since the 1930s to treat industrial wastewater, centrifuges use the force from a rapidly rotating cylindrical bowl to remove solids from a liquid. This high-speed process effectively cleans your water through the centrifugal thickening and dewatering of sewage sludge.
